>
>
Product details
Toadstool Patch
Toadstool Patch
Toadstool Patch

Toadstool Patch

  • (0) reviews
Model:
#2693443
Availability:
In stock
  • $20.61 $31
Colour
  • Blue
QTY:
-
+

Toadstool Patch

  • (0) reviews
Model:
#2693443
Availability:
In stock
  • $20.61 $31
Colour
  • Blue
QTY:
-
+
Patch